WebMar 24, 2024 · Inside your lungs, the bronchial tubes branch into thousands of thinner tubes called bronchioles. The bronchioles end in clusters of tiny air sacs called alveoli. Air fills your lung’s air sacs Your lungs have about 150 million alveoli. Normally, your alveoli are elastic, meaning that their size and shape can change easily. CT scan of the chest: Your doctor is looking for an air- and fluid-filled cavity in the ... iobit malware fighter 8 pro downloadWebNov 17, 2024 · Pneumonia is an infection of the lungs that may be caused by bacteria, viruses, or fungi. The infection causes the lungs' air sacs (alveoli) to become inflamed and fill up with fluid or pus. That can make it hard for the oxygen you breathe in to get into your bloodstream.
